Fun story on why the german rocket was so much bigger than the american bazooka.

They captured a group of americans and during interrogation demanded to know more about this rumored shoulder fired rocket the americans were cooking up.

The americans gave them outlandishly large (for rocket tech at the time) measurements on its diameter and range.

They said the bazooka that was going to be coming onto the battlefield soon would be a 6 inch rocket with a 300 yard range (it was a 3 inch rocket with a 100 yard accurate range)

So the nazis actually built a rocket similar to those diameters and specs in order to keep up.

I think it was more of his megalomania showing through.

When the original line of panzer designs were ran it was done on the orders of his generals and advisors, and the series was noteworthy for being the first mass produced armor line that utilized rapid manuever warfare.

As the war turned against him he began increasingly micromanaging his military and preventing his quite frankly highly competent staff from making decisions.

As soon as hitler began dictating design features everything turned into this cartoony amatuerish obsession with colossal size and wierd only useful in 1 or 2 situation type designs.

Once politicians begin trying to fight wars things get pretty stupid pretty quick.

Remote controlled anti-tank mines.

Had a 300 meter wire spool connected to a hand controller, you could drive it into a tank or use it to wipe out a machinegun nest (had like a 100 pound bomb inside of it.)

They broke down a lot and werent ever made in very large numbers to begin with.

biggest joke of the war. To use this gun; 3800 men took 4 weeks to prepare the site. 1500 men took a few days to assemble it. 250 men were required just to fire it. Assuming no breakdowns (kek), it could fire around a dozen per day and after 300 shots the barrel had to be replaced (250 test shots and 48 actually used in combat ruined the original). Each projectile was shaped slightly different and had to be shot in a specific order because of the physical changes to the barrel from firing the artillery. The DESIGN of the t-34 was better. The manufacturing not so much.

Keep in mind T-34's were being built in factories in a warzone under frequent bombing, some literally rolled off the assembly lines and went straight to combat before theyd even been painted.

The shermans were made in the US where nobody was hungry, matierials and supply lines were utterly free and un-disrupted, and yeah, there was a sense of urgency in the Sherman's manufacturing but not a "the enemy is only 12 miles away from the factory" level of urgency.
